Description:
The United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) is seeking professional and experienced patent legal advisory support to the Office of Patent Legal Administration (OPLA). The contractor will provide support services to assist OPLA with patent policy examination support, including working with complex and specialized areas of patent law. The contractor's personnel shall have expertise and experience in the administration of patent law through the review, analysis, and dissemination of patent examination policy used to issue patents for inventions in the various arts. The key responsibilities of the contractor may include: • Drafting regulations and developing practices for the examination of patent applications • Assisting in the implementation of new regulations and practices • Reviewing and revising regulatory notices published in the Federal Register, Official Gazette, or both • Monitoring public comments and formulating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) • Recommending updates to the Manual of Patent Examining Procedures (MPEP) and forms used by the Patent Examining Corps (Corps) and external customers • Preparing and delivering training to the Patent Corps
